Choosing the Right Door Rollers for Sliding Doors


Sliding doors are a popular choice for both residential and commercial spaces due to their space-saving design and ease of use. Whether you are installing a new sliding door or replacing rollers on an existing door, selecting the right door rollers is crucial for ensuring smooth operation and longevity. In this article, we will explore the different types of door rollers available for sliding doors, their components, and tips for maintenance and installation.


Understanding Door Rollers


Door rollers are essential components of sliding doors, allowing them to glide open and closed with minimal resistance. Typically made of durable materials like nylon or metal, these rollers come in various shapes and sizes to accommodate different door weights and designs. The efficiency of a sliding door greatly depends on the quality of its rollers, which must match the door's specifications for optimal performance.


Types of Door Rollers


1. Top-Mounted Rollers These rollers are installed at the top of the sliding door frame. They support most of the door’s weight, making them ideal for heavy doors. Top-mounted rollers can be adjusted to ensure proper alignment and smooth operation.


2. Bottom-Mounted Rollers Positioned at the base of the sliding door, these rollers help guide the door's movement along the track. They often work in conjunction with top-mounted rollers, providing stability. Bottom-mounted rollers are less visible but just as critical to the sliding mechanism.


3. Ball Bearing Rollers These rollers include ball bearings that reduce friction during operation, making them an excellent choice for heavy or frequently used sliding doors. Ball bearing rollers provide a smoother and quieter sliding experience compared to standard rollers.


4. Vinyl Rollers Made from durable vinyl, these rollers are an economical option for lightweight sliding doors such as those made of aluminum or fiberglass. While they may not support heavy doors, vinyl rollers are resistant to corrosion and wear, making them suitable for areas with high humidity.

Installation Tips


Installing door rollers for sliding doors can be a straightforward DIY project if you follow the proper guidelines. Here are some tips to ensure a successful installation


1. Measure Carefully Before purchasing new rollers, measure the existing ones to ensure compatibility. Consider factors such as door weight, height, and width to select the appropriate roller type.


2. Choose Quality Materials Invest in high-quality rollers to ensure durability and smooth operation. Though cheaper options may be available, they often require more frequent replacements.


3. Follow Manufacturer Instructions Always refer to the manufacturer's installation guidelines for specific details about the roller type you are working with. Proper alignment is crucial for the optimal functioning of sliding doors.


4. Regular Maintenance Keeping door rollers clean and lubricated will prolong their lifespan. Check for dirt buildup and apply a suitable lubricant periodically to ensure smooth operation.
